Full Description
Clothes fastener (hook tag) of Tudor Style. Consists of a rectangular gold mount with relief heart and pellet decoration and eight evenly spaced lobes protuding from the edge of the mount. A rectangular silver loop and hook are attached to the back. Dimensions of the mount - 9mm x 13mm. Length including hook is 18mm. Fasteners of this type are known in copper alloy or sometimes silver- according to the British Museum the use of gold and silver is most unusual. Dated 16th, possibly 17th century. Found by metal detector.
